Main compound image
ezetimibe-glucuronide sch 60663
  • Other Name: Ezetimibe glucuronide
  • InChIKey: UOFYCFMTERCNEW-ADEYADIWSA-N
  • InChI: InChI=1S/C30H29F2NO9/c31-17-5-1-15(2-6-17)22(34)14-13-21-23(33(28(21)38)19-9-7-18(32)8-10-19)16-3-11-20(12-4-16)41-30-26(37)24(35)25(36)27(42-30)29(39)40/h1-12,21-27,30,34-37H,13-14H2,(H,39,40)/t21-,22+,23-,24+,25+,26-,27+,30-/m1/s1
  • SMILES: C1=CC(=CC=C1[C@@H]2[C@H](C(=O)N2C3=CC=C(C=C3)F)CC[C@@H](C4=CC=C(C=C4)F)O)O[C@H]5[C@@H]([C@H]([C@@H]([C@H](O5)C(=O)O)O)O)O
  • Exact Mass: 585.18104
  • Molecular Formula: C30H29F2NO9
  • Compound CID: pubchemlite9894653 pubchem9894653
Hidden Reactions Filter Some biological reactions link very small precursors (e.g. CO₂, acetate) to much larger products. These reactions are correct, but they can create unrealistic shortest paths and connect otherwise separate parts of the graph. To keep the overview readable, FAIR-TPs hides six such reactions where a <60 Da precursor leads to a >300 Da product in the visualisations.

You can have all these paths in the download output.
Hidden reaction pairs (precursor → product):
  • Acetate → N-(2-benzoyl-4-chlorophenyl)-2-acetamidoacetamide
  • Acetate → N-(2-benzoyl-4-chlorophenyl)-2-acetamido-n-methylacetamide
  • Carbon dioxide → Formylmethanofuran
  • Acrolein → Chembl3706542
  • Ethylene oxide → Acetyl-coa
  • Formaldehyde → S-hydroxymethylglutathione
